Molecular Preadaptation to Antimony Resistance in Leishmania donovani on the Indian Subcontinent.
mSphere - 25 Apr 2018
Dumetz F, Cuypers B, Imamura H, Zander D, D'Haenens E, Maes I, Domagalska M A, Clos J, Dujardin J-C, De Muylder G
Abstract excerpt
Antimonials (Sb) were used for decades for chemotherapy of visceral leishmaniasis (VL). Now abandoned in the Indian subcontinent (ISC) because of Leishmania donovani resistance, this drug offers a unique model for understanding drug resistance dynamics. In a previous phylogenomic study, we found two distinct populations of L. donovani: the core group (CG) in the Gangetic plains and ISC1 in the Nepalese highlands....
